Automatic input data preparation for global and local ship strength calculation in accordance with IACS Common Structural Rules as a software development task

Authors: V.N. Tryaskin, S.V. Rumin, M.A. Kuteynikov, M.S. Boyko

Abstract

The article provides the characteristics of the software developed to perform the hull structural strength verification for oil tankers and bulk carriers in accordance with IACS Common Structural Rules. The characteristics of several software modules, intended for the preparation of input data required to check the ship structures for compliance with Common Structure Rules global and local strength criteria are also given, together with the description of the main steps necessary to prepare geometrical models and structural databases for hull girder cross-section, flat and corrugated bulkheads. The pictures of the software interface are provided, as well as the software menu structure description.
